IUPAC Name:(2R)-2-(phenylmethoxymethyl)oxirane
Molecular Formula:C10H12O2
Molecular Weight:164.201080 g/mol
Boiling Point:130 °C (0.1 mmHg)
Flash Point:>230 °F
alpha:-5.4 °(c=5 in toluene)
density:1.077 g/mL at 25 °C(lit.)
refractive index:n20/D 1.517(lit.)
BRN:3588399

Safety Information of (R)-O-BENZYLGLYCIDOL(14618-80-5):
Hazard Codes:Xi
Risk Statements:36/37/38
36/37/38: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in
Safety Statements:26-36-37/39
26:In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ice
36:Wear suitable protective clothing
37/39:Wear suitable gloves and eye/face protection
WGK Germany:3
RTECS:TX2860020
Mutation data reported. When heated to decomposition it emits acrid smoke and irritating vapors.
